<strong>Copley</strong> Amplifier Parameter Dictionary Filter Coefficients<br />

For the plus family of drives (Xenus+, AEM, etc), a new format is used to <strong>de</strong>scribe the biquad filter coefficients. These drives inclu<strong>de</strong> the<br />

ability to <strong>de</strong>sign the filters in firmware using the Cephes filter <strong>de</strong>sign library.<br />

Filters on this family of drives are calculated internally using 32-bit IEEE floating point coefficients. The format of the <strong>parameter</strong> information<br />

passed when setting filter <strong>parameter</strong>s on these drives consists of an array of up to fourteen 16-bit words. The first 4 words <strong>de</strong>scribe the filter,<br />

and the remaining 10 words give the filter coefficients as 32-bit IEEE floating point values. The filter coefficient words are optional and are<br />

only necessary if the firmware is not calculating the coefficients internally.<br />

Word Description<br />

1 Bit Usage<br />

0-3 Filter family.<br />

4 If set, filter will not be <strong>de</strong>signed. Always set by firmware after successfully <strong>de</strong>signing the<br />

filter. This prevents the filter from being re<strong>de</strong>signed when copied from flash at startup.<br />

5-7 Reserved.<br />

8 Number of poles – 1 (i.e. 0 for single pole, 1 for two pole).<br />

9-12 Reserved.<br />

13-15 Filter type.<br />

All reserved bits should be set to zero.<br />

The filter family should be one of the following values:<br />

0 Custom biquad filter. Coefficients must be passed; the firmware will not <strong>de</strong>sign the filter.<br />

1 Butterworth filter.<br />

2 Chebychev filter.<br />

3 Elliptic filter.<br />

4-15 Reserved.<br />

The filter type should be one of the following:<br />

0 Custom biquad filter. Coefficients must be passed; the firmware will not <strong>de</strong>sign the filter.<br />

1 Low pass.<br />

2 High pass.<br />

3 Band reject (notch).<br />

4 Band pass.<br />

5-6 Reserved<br />
